Did you know that Rathdown School wasn’t always a co-educational school? It was founded in 1973. It was, for a long time, an all-girls school. Rathdown School is an independent school for day and boarding students up to the age of eighteen. It’s located in a beautiful setting on Glenageary Road on the edge of Dublin. It’s one of the most prestigious schools in Ireland. Rathdown School proudly boasts an impressive history. The school was actually formed from four existing schools: The Hall, Hillcourt, Park House, and Glengara Park. Each of these schools became known as a house in the new school, with names like ‘Hall House’ and ‘Hillcourt House’ In the early 20th century, Glenageary was where a young Wilfred P. Tonne, in 1922, founded Hillcourt School. The school became a boarding school for girls. He named the school after Hillcourt, the house where he lived. The Hall was a large, imposing building which became a school for girls in 1872. It was one of the first schools to introduce judo and fencing for girls. One of the school’s most famous students was Jennifer Johnston, who later grew up to be a well-known novelist. In 1932, Lilian Mary Rouviere Fayle founded Park House in Donnybrook, a suburb of Dublin. It was a mixed school and it was a preparatory school for Sandford Park. In 1973, Park House and The Hall merged to form ‘Park Hall’. You can see the beautiful, historic grounds of Rathdown School spread over 16 acres, just 12 kilometres from Dublin City Centre, behind the school gates. It stands as a testament to its rich history and distinguished alumni but don’t forget that Rathdown School remains a place of constant evolution. It was in 2022 when the school made the innovative choice to become co-educational and it has continued to grow ever since, today welcoming both boys and girls alike. It’s a school that’s known for its commitment to academic achievement as well as the arts and sports. Rathdown School is a true gem of education in Dublin.
